SEAS Welcomes Three New Faculty Members

Professor Howie Huang

Professor Howie Huang has joined SEAS as an assistant professor in the Department of Electrical and Computer Engineering. Before joining SEAS, Huang completed his Ph.D. in computer science from the University of Virginia. He earned his M.S. from Colorado School of Mines, and B.S. from Wuhan University, China. His research interests include high performance computing, grid computing, and computer architecture.

 

 

Professor Nan Zhang

Professor Nan Zhang has joined SEAS as an assistant professor in the Department of Computer Science. Before joining SEAS, he was an assistant professor of computer science and engineering for two years at the University of Texas at Arlington. Zhang earned his Ph.D. in computer science from Texas A&M University and his B.S. in computer science from Peking University, China. He is a National Science Foundation Career Award winner whose research interests include security and privacy issues in databases, data mining, and computer networks. The topics he researches include: security and anonymity in data collection, publishing, and sharing; privacy-preserving data mining; and wireless network security and privacy.

 

 

Professor Yongsheng Leng

Professor Yongsheng Leng has joined SEAS as an assistant professor in the Department of Mechanical and Aerospace Engineering. Before joining SEAS, he was a research assistant professor of chemical engineering at Vanderbilt University, Nashville, Tennessee, for two and a half years. Professor Leng earned his Ph.D. and M.S. in mechanics and tribology (the science of friction, lubrication and wear between two solid surfaces) from Tsinghua University (China), and his B.S. in mechanical engineering from North China University of Technology. His research projects, supported by the National Science Foundation and the Department of Defense, focus mainly on computational materials science at nanometer scales. Research interests include computational nanotribology, molecular modeling of self-assembly at organo-metallic interfaces, nanomechanics, mechanical property of metal nanowires, and the development of computational methodology.



 

National Science Foundation Awards Five Grants to Computer Science Faculty

In August and September, five faculty members from the Department of Computer Science received a total of $1.32 million in grants from the National Science Foundation (NSF) to support their research.

Professors Rahul Simha and Bhagirath Narahari received a $600,000 four-year grant from the NSF’s Cybertrust program to support a research project entitled, "Hardware Containers for Software Components." The award is part of a $1 million project in collaboration with researchers from Northwestern University and Iowa State University. The project is part of Simha’s and Narahari’s ongoing research, which explores how additional hardware can be utilized to provide more secure computer systems. Their projects in this research area have thus far received over $2 million in total funding from the NSF and the Air Force Office of Sponsored Research.

Professor Poorvi Vora received a two-year $164,478 NSF grant, also from the Cybertrust program, for research on voting systems. Vora explains, “The challenge of a voting system is to prove to voters and observers that the tally is correct, without violating the privacy of the individual voter.” With this research, Vora and doctoral student Ben Hosp hope to be able to understand the privacy limits of the practical voter-verifiable voting systems, using an information-theoretic model that they have developed.

Vora also has received another NSF grant to study statistical cryptanalysis of block ciphers as channel communication. Through this two-year, $125,643 grant, Vora and her team hope to begin an effort to define a framework for cipher attacks so they may better understand how to design good ciphers that avoid the attacks.

Professors Xiuzhen “Susan” Cheng and Hyeong-Ah Choi received a four-year, $330,000 grant to study a number of fundamental problems critical to mesh network throughput optimization—a process that attempts to optimize the total amount of traffic delivered through a network within a unit of time. Because their project requires joint effort from computer science, electrical engineering, mathematics, statistics, and biology, Prof. Cheng believes that it has the potential to inspire interesting methodologies that could be applied to many domains.

Separately, Professor Choi received a two-year, $100,000 grant to support a research project entitled, “Resource Management in Secure Open Wireless Networks.” Her research project explores three key issues in the resource management of secure open wireless networks: access selection, QoS scheduling, and security management. Prof. Choi expects that the results obtained through this research will enhance the resource management in next generation wireless networks with multi-access environments.



 

Prof. Pelton to Retire

 

Joseph Pelton, research professor of engineering in the Department of Electrical Engineering, will be retiring from SEAS at the end of October. After 30 years in the satellite communications field, he joined GW in 1999, working initially with the Institute for Applied Space Research (IASR) and then serving as director of the MS Program in Telecommunications and Computers, located at GW’s Virginia Campus. He later consolidated the research projects he had at the Virginia campus and the activities of the IASR to create the Space & Advanced Communications Research Institute (SACRI).

Dr. Pelton’s research work at GW has included advanced satellite design concepts for the Communications Research Lab of Japan, the National Institute of Information and Communications Technology, three major studies on space safety related to the Space Shuttle, research for Northrop Grumman, setting up a communications research lab at the Virginia Campus under sponsorship from the State of Virginia's Center for Innovative Technology, and organizing three major space related conferences. Also while at GW, he was appointed by the Diet of Japan to be an external evaluator of the Japanese Space Program and by NASA and the National Science Foundation to be a co-chairman of a global review of satellite communications technology.

Upon retirement, Dr. Pelton says that he will continue writing a series of books, support programs of the International Space University, and continue working with a number of foundations and professional associations.



 

SEAS Alumni Scott Amey and Julie Lee Receive Alumni Achievement Awards

Mr. Scott Amey
2008 Distinguished Alumni Achievement Award Recipient

Ms. Julie Lee
2008 Recent Alumni Achievement Award Recipient

 

On September 25th, GW honored seven alumni with achievement awards, and two of them are SEAS alumni. Mr. Scott Amey, MS (computer science) ’75, was presented with the Distinguished Alumni Achievement Award, and Ms. Julie Lee, MS (systems engineering) ’05 with the Recent Alumni Achievement Award.

Scott co-founded RS Information Systems (RSIS), a company that provides advanced technical and business solutions in information technology, systems engineering and other areas, to the defense, civilian, and law enforcement agencies of the federal government. Before he retired in 2004, he helped grow the company to 1,700 employees, and in 2005, the company was ranked 35th on the Washington Technology list of the largest federal technology services contractors.

After his retirement, Scott served for roughly three years as the volunteer director of the SEAS Career Services Office, dedicating three days a week to helping our students start their careers. He was also very active in helping Georgetown’s Lombardi cancer center where his daughter had been successfully treated.

Scott subsequently started another company, Amyx Inc., which has already grown to 70 employees and which he leads as its president and chief executive officer.

Julie Lee is the president, and chief executive officer of Access Systems, Inc., which provides IT services to the federal government and has been recognized by the Virginia Chamber of Commerce as one of Virginia’s fastest growing companies (2004-2008). It has also been recognized by Inside Business magazine as one of the best places to work in the state, and named among Washington Technology’s “Fast 50” for seven years in a row (2002-2008). From 1998-1999, Julie served as president and chief executive officer of ATECH Corporation.

Julie is an active member of numerous industry organizations, most notably as a member of the Director’s Advisory Council on Women’s Business of the Virginia Department of Business Assistance, an organization to which she was appointed in 2003 by then Governor Mark Warner. In 2006, she received the Entrepreneur of the Year Award from the Small Business Administration in the DC area. She was named one of Fifty Most Influential Minorities in Business by the Minority Business and Professional Network in 2002 and 2004, as well as a Minority Small Business Advocate by the Asian American Business Roundtable in 2004. Julie is active in a number of local and national volunteer organizations, and she is currently pursuing her doctoral degree in engineering management here at SEAS.
